Duties and Responsibilities
Participates in the selection of strategies to implement evidence-based wellness and prevention initiatives.
Participates in initial care plan development including specific goals for all enrollees.
Communicates with medical providers, subspecialty providers including mental health and substance abuse service providers, long term care and hospitals regarding records including admission and discharge.
Provides education and resources around health conditions, treatment recommendation, medications, and strategies to implement care plan goals, including both clinical and non-clinical needs.

Monitors assessments and screenings to assure findings are integrated in the care plan.
Facilitates the use of the Electronic Health Record (EHR) and other Health Information Technology (HIT) to link services, facilitate communication among team members and provide feedback.
Monitors and reports on performance measures and outcomes.
Meets regularly with the care team to plan care and discuss cases and exchanges appropriate information with team members in an informal manner as part of the daily routine of the clinic.
Collaborates as part of an interdisciplinary team in assessing, planning, implementing, and evaluating services for individuals with psychiatric, co-morbid, and/or co-occurring psychiatric and substance use disorders.
Works with program psychiatrists in meeting the psychiatric/ medical needs of individuals.
Skilled at listening, engaging and responding to individuals at various stages or readiness for change; those in crisis; and those with complex issues such as co-occurring psychiatric and substance use disorders.
Demonstrates knowledge of principles of trauma informed care.
Willingness to support and assist consumers with trauma related issues.
